How to Use HighLevel Snapshots to Rollback Changes Without Data Loss

In the fast-paced world of digital marketing and client management, accidental changes or configuration errors within your HighLevel account can lead to significant operational disruptions. HighLevel Snapshots offer a robust safety net, allowing agencies and businesses to efficiently rollback unwanted changes, restore previous configurations, and maintain data integrity without the fear of permanent data loss. This guide will walk you through the strategic application of HighLevel Snapshots, ensuring your critical workflows remain resilient and your client data secure.

Step 1: Understand the Power and Scope of HighLevel Snapshots

Before initiating any rollback, it’s crucial to grasp what a HighLevel Snapshot truly is and what it encompasses. A Snapshot captures the complete configuration of a sub-account at a specific point in time, including pipelines, custom fields, campaigns, triggers, forms, websites, and more. It does not typically include contact data or conversational history, which live independently. Understanding this distinction is key to successful restoration. This feature acts as a blueprint, allowing you to replicate or revert the entire structural setup of a sub-account, making it invaluable for testing new setups, deploying standardized templates, or recovering from configuration mistakes. Knowing its scope prevents misexpectations and ensures you leverage its capabilities effectively for structural recovery.

Step 2: Proactive Snapshot Creation – Your First Line of Defense

The most effective use of HighLevel Snapshots begins with a proactive strategy of regular creation. Always take a Snapshot before implementing any major changes, deploying new campaigns, integrating third-party tools, or onboarding a new client with a customized setup. This establishes a known good configuration that you can always revert to. Access the Snapshots feature within your agency account settings, select the sub-account, and initiate the Snapshot process, giving it a clear, descriptive name and date (e.g., “Client X – Pre-Campaign Launch – 2023-10-26”). This disciplined approach ensures you have a recovery point readily available, minimizing the potential impact of unforeseen issues and providing peace of mind during complex operations.

Step 3: Identifying the Need for a Rollback

Recognizing when a rollback is necessary is as important as knowing how to execute it. Common scenarios include: an erroneous workflow update that sends incorrect communications, a deleted or altered landing page template, or a misconfigured trigger causing system-wide issues. Symptoms often involve disrupted client communication, broken automations, or missing elements within your HighLevel account. Before initiating a rollback, isolate the specific issue and determine the approximate date of the last known good configuration. This diagnostic step helps you select the correct Snapshot, avoiding the restoration of a state that might introduce new, unrelated problems. A systematic review saves time and ensures a targeted, effective recovery.

Step 4: Previewing and Applying the Snapshot Restore

HighLevel provides a critical “Restore Preview” feature that allows you to see exactly what changes a Snapshot will apply before committing to the restoration. This is an indispensable step to prevent unintended overwrites. When applying a Snapshot to a sub-account, you will be presented with a detailed comparison of the current configuration versus the Snapshot’s configuration. Carefully review all elements—pipelines, forms, custom fields, campaigns—to ensure that the Snapshot contains the desired state and will not inadvertently remove current, necessary configurations. This granular preview empowers you to make informed decisions, selecting only the necessary components for restoration or confirming a full system rollback without unexpected consequences, preserving valuable live data.

Step 5: Executing the Rollback and Post-Restoration Validation

Once you’ve confidently reviewed the Restore Preview, proceed with applying the Snapshot. HighLevel will then begin the process of overriding the current sub-account configuration with the chosen Snapshot’s settings. While the platform handles the technical execution, your role shifts to rigorous validation. Immediately after the restoration, conduct thorough checks across the affected sub-account. Verify that all restored elements—workflows, forms, landing pages, custom fields—are functioning as expected. Send test communications, submit test forms, and check lead capture mechanisms. This post-restoration audit confirms the success of the rollback and ensures that the sub-account is fully operational and aligned with its intended configuration. Any lingering issues should be addressed promptly, potentially requiring further targeted adjustments.

Step 6: Integrate Snapshot Management into Your Operational Protocols

To truly harness the power of HighLevel Snapshots, integrate their management into your standard operating procedures. This means establishing a clear policy for when Snapshots should be taken, how they should be named, and who is responsible for their oversight. For agencies managing multiple client accounts, this might involve scheduled weekly or monthly Snapshots, alongside event-driven Snapshots before any major client-specific deployments. Training your team on these protocols ensures consistency and readiness. A robust Snapshot management strategy is not merely a reactive recovery tool; it’s a proactive component of your data governance and operational excellence framework, safeguarding your agency’s efficiency and client success in the long term.

If you would like to read more, we recommend this article: Mastering Safe HighLevel Data Recovery for HR & Recruiting: The Power of Restore Previews

By Published On: December 29, 2025

Ready to Start Automating?

Let’s talk about what’s slowing you down—and how to fix it together.

Share This Story, Choose Your Platform!